2017-10-04 15 views
1

compileSdkVersion 24に実行時許可マネージャを使用し、minSdkVersionが23の場合、必要な権限(ex-WRITE_EXTERNAL_STORAGEの場合)をマニフェストファイルに含める必要がありますか?実行時許可の処理

+0

それ以外の場合はエラー –

+0

https://developer.android.com/guide/topics/permissions/requesting.html#normal-危険なものになる –

+0

はい、マニフェストにもそれらを保管してください。実行時のアクセス権を簡単に処理できるようにライブラリをチェックしてください。 https://github.com/nabinbhandari/Android-Permissions –

答えて

3

はい、すべてのアクセス許可は、実行時アクセス許可として実装されているかどうかにかかわらず、AndroidManifest.xmlファイルで明示的に宣言されます。

2

はい、実行時に使用する場合でも、すべてのアクセス許可をmanifest.xmlファイルに含める必要があります。それ以外の場合は実行されません。それについての詳細はhere です。ありがとう

1

はい、AndroidManifest.xmlに必要な権限を宣言する必要があります。

パーミッションモーダルは、マシュマロ以上のプラットフォームでのみ機能します。

marshmallowより小さいバージョンをサポートするには、それらを宣言する必要があります。

関連する問題